Add 60/84 and 72/90
60/84 + 72/90 is 53/35.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 84 and 90 is 1260
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1260 - For the 1st fraction, since 84 × 15 = 1260,
60/84 = 60 × 15/84 × 15 = 900/1260 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 90 × 14 = 1260,
72/90 = 72 × 14/90 × 14 = 1008/1260 - Add the two like fractions:
900/1260 + 1008/1260 = 900 + 1008/1260 = 1908/1260 - 1908/1260 simplified gives 53/35
- So, 60/84 + 72/90 = 53/35
In mixed form: 118/35
